真空开关介质强度恢复的研究

摘    要:电力系统的瞬态恢复电压对真空开关的介质强度恢复影响极大,根据是否考虑这一影响可把真空开关的介质恢复过程分为实际恢复过程和固有恢复过程。本文在相同的实验模型和电路参数下对这两种恢复过程作了比较性的实验研究。提出了“鞘层”与“金属蒸气”相结合的理论模型,并对相关的问题进行了讨论。

An Investigation on Dielectric Strength Recovery of a Vacuum Switch

Abstract:Transient voltage in a power system significantly affects the dielectric strength recovery of a vacuum switch. Depending on whether or not this effect is taken into consideration, the dielectric recovery process can be divided into actual recovery and inherent recovery processes. Experimental investigations have been made on both processes under identical conditions and a theoretical model by combining "sheath" and "residual neutral" is proposed. Relevant problems are discussed.
